网站开发时间安排,wordpress删除版权,网页设计是什么意思,wordpress检测登录ip引言
在编程的世界里#xff0c;集成开发环境#xff08;IDE#xff09;是我们日常工作的重要工具。无论是初学者还是经验丰富的开发者#xff0c;一个好的IDE都能极大地提高我们的编程效率。那么#xff0c;什么是IDE呢#xff1f;对于新手来说#xff0c;又应该选择哪…
引言
在编程的世界里集成开发环境IDE是我们日常工作的重要工具。无论是初学者还是经验丰富的开发者一个好的IDE都能极大地提高我们的编程效率。那么什么是IDE呢对于新手来说又应该选择哪个IDE呢本文将带你探索IDE的世界并为你推荐几款适合新手的IDE。
一、什么是IDE
IDE全称Integrated Development Environment即集成开发环境。它是一个软件应用程序提供了创建、编辑、编译、调试和运行程序的完整环境。在IDE中我们可以编写代码、管理项目、构建和测试应用程序而无需在不同的工具之间切换。
IDE通常包含以下功能
代码编辑器提供语法高亮、代码自动补全、代码片段等功能帮助开发者更高效地编写代码。编译器和解释器将源代码转换为机器代码或字节码以便在计算机上运行。调试器允许开发者在运行时检查代码查找和修复错误。项目管理工具帮助开发者组织和管理项目中的文件和依赖项。版本控制系统集成如Git方便开发者管理和跟踪代码的更改。
二、适合新手的IDE推荐
对于新手来说选择一个易于上手、功能齐全的IDE非常重要。以下是几款适合新手的IDE推荐
Visual Studio Code (VS Code)
VS Code是微软开发的一款免费、开源的IDE支持多种编程语言。它拥有丰富的插件生态系统可以满足各种开发需求。界面简洁、易上手非常适合新手入门。
PyCharm
如果你正在学习Python编程那么PyCharm绝对是一个不错的选择。PyCharm由JetBrains开发专为Python开发者设计。它提供了强大的代码分析、调试和项目管理功能帮助你更高效地编写Python代码。
Eclipse
Eclipse是一个开放源代码的、基于Java的可扩展开发平台。它最初被设计为IDE用于Java语言开发但现在已支持多种其他语言如C、PHP和Ruby等。对于学习Java的新手来说Eclipse是一个非常合适的选择。
IntelliJ IDEA
IntelliJ IDEA是另一款由JetBrains开发的强大IDE主要用于Java开发。虽然它的学习曲线可能比VS Code或PyCharm稍微陡峭一些但对于想要深入学习Java的新手来说IntelliJ IDEA提供了丰富的功能和强大的性能。
总结
选择一个合适的IDE对于编程新手来说至关重要。以上推荐的几款IDE都具有易上手、功能齐全的特点适合新手入门。当然随着你的编程技能不断提高你可能会发现其他更适合你的IDE。不过无论选择哪个IDE最重要的是保持学习和探索的热情不断提升自己的编程能力。